  • What electrical code violations show up most often during home inspections in Plant City?

    Inspections frequently flag outdated panels, improper grounding, missing GFCI protection in wet areas, and amateur wiring from previous DIY work. Older homes may have aluminum wiring or insufficient circuit capacity for modern loads. Correcting these issues before closing prevents delays and addresses actual safety concerns rather than cosmetic problems.
  • Can your existing electrical panel support an EV charger installation?

    Most Level 2 EV chargers require a dedicated 40-60 amp circuit, which older 100-amp or heavily loaded panels often can't accommodate. Watsons assesses your current panel capacity, existing electrical loads, and charging needs before installation. If capacity is insufficient, a service upgrade happens first to prevent overloading and tripped breakers.
  • What's the difference between residential rewiring and electrical remodeling work?

    Rewiring replaces outdated or unsafe wiring throughout the home, often in older properties with deteriorated insulation or insufficient circuits. Electrical remodeling adapts existing systems to new layouts—relocating outlets, adding circuits for renovations, or supporting changed room functions. Both require evaluating current infrastructure, but rewiring addresses safety while remodeling addresses functionality.

  • How do you know if outdated electrical work in an older home needs immediate attention?

    Frequent breaker trips, flickering lights, warm outlets, burning smells, or visible wire damage indicate urgent issues. Homes built before the 1980s may have aluminum wiring, ungrounded circuits, or insufficient capacity for modern appliances. These conditions create fire risk and should be evaluated by an electrician familiar with updating older residential systems safely.

  • Why does electrical panel capacity matter when planning home improvements?

    Adding pools, workshops, EV chargers, or HVAC systems increases electrical load, and panels with insufficient amperage can't safely distribute the additional demand. Overloaded panels trip breakers, create fire hazards, and prevent new equipment from operating properly. Evaluating capacity before improvements prevents costly rework and ensures the electrical system supports both current and planned usage.

  • Why does EV charger installation sometimes require a panel upgrade?

    Level 2 EV chargers draw 30-50 amps continuously, similar to running a second air conditioner. If your panel is near capacity or uses an older 100-amp service, adding that load without upgrading risks tripping breakers or overheating.   • What's the difference between residential electrical remodeling and rewiring?

    Remodeling electrical adapts existing systems to new layouts—relocating outlets, adding circuits for new appliances, or updating fixture locations during renovations. Rewiring replaces outdated or unsafe wiring throughout the home, typically in older properties with cloth wiring, aluminum branch circuits, or insufficient grounding. The scope depends on what's failing versus what's just being rearranged.

  • What factors affect electrical panel replacement cost?

    Panel cost varies based on amperage capacity (100-amp versus 200-amp service), whether the utility meter and service lines need upgrading, panel location accessibility, and how many circuits transfer to the new box. Properties requiring service line upgrades or utility coordination involve additional material and permitting costs beyond the panel itself.
  • Can you add a generator to an existing home without major electrical work?

    Generator installation requires a transfer switch, dedicated circuit, and sometimes panel modifications depending on what you want powered during outages. Homes with newer panels and available breaker space typically need less additional work than properties with maxed-out or outdated electrical systems.   • How do you know if older home wiring needs replacement or just repairs?

    Wiring replacement makes sense when you have cloth-insulated wiring, aluminum branch circuits in living areas, frequent breaker trips, or insufficient grounding throughout the home. Isolated issues like a single bad circuit or outdated fixtures usually just need targeted repairs. The deciding factor is whether the problem is systemic or localized.
